Toy Retailer Zany Brainy to Drop Video Games
|
Zany Brainy, the 170-store toy specialist, announced yesterday
that it plans to stop selling video games by year-end, saying there
aren't enough console games appropriate for the chain's target
audience, children ages 3 to 10.
The retailer, which has 13 Washington area locations, will start
slashing prices by this weekend to get rid of its remaining titles.
"We thought there would be a lot of product developed for our age
group, but it just didn't happen," said Jerry R. Welch, chief
executive of FAO Inc., which also owns Right Start and FAO Schwarz.
